Overview
The Evolution 58GX2 is the most powerful engine in its class with superior porting and an advanced electronic ignition system unique to Evolution. Each system is easy to start, with automatically controlled timing advance for maximum performance and two fail-safe features, an auto-cut-off after ninety seconds of inactivity, and a low battery engine rev limiter which reduces the engine rpm by 3000rpm, this provides an audible warning that it is time to land and recharge the ignition battery pack. The rear mounted Walbro carburettor allows a direct throttle linkage to be used, and the anodised multi-bolt prop hub provides a safe and secure mounting for the large propellers that this powerful engine is capable of turning. A deeply finned front crankcase reduces weight, and substantial ball bearings support the crankshaft, which reduces the risk of crankshaft flex and aids smooth running, deeply finned cylinder head fins allow for maximum airflow and cooling. Anodised aluminium rear beam mounts allow the engine to be mounted easily and positioned through 360 degrees. The engine is designed to run on a petrol oil mix at a ratio of 1-30 during running-in, and a bottle of running-in oil is supplied, this mix may be altered to 1-40 after running-in is completed. The ignition unit comes with a shielded spark plug lead, cap, mini spark plug and plug spanner, and operates on a 4.8 to 6Volt battery pack

Bore: 1.65 in (42.00 mm)
Stroke: 1.65 in (42.00 mm)
Cylinders: Single
Mounting Dimensions: 243 x 78 x 140 mm
Cylinder Type: Ring
Engine Weight: 1820 g (64.2 oz)
Benchmark Prop: 24 x 10 @ 6,900
Prop Range: 22 x 10 - 26 x 10
RPM Range: 1,000 - 7,500
Fuel: Gas/Oil mix 40:1
HP: 8.5 hp @ 6950 rpm
Starting system: Electronic Ignition
Crankshaft Threads: M10 X 1.0 mm
Carb Type: Walbro
Crank Type: Ball Bearing
